6.3 Portfolio News Tracker

The Portfolio News Tracker bot within the Orbit platform is designed to continuously monitor and aggregate key news related to a specified portfolio of companies. This bot filters and curates relevant information, ensuring that investors and analysts stay informed about significant developments that could impact their investments. By keeping track of news across a portfolio, users can quickly respond to market events, corporate announcements, and other critical updates that may affect their investment strategies.

What the Portfolio News Tracker Bot Does:

  • Continuous Monitoring: The bot continuously scans and aggregates news from various sources related to the companies in a user’s portfolio.

  • Relevance Filtering: It filters the news to ensure that only the most relevant and impactful information is surfaced, helping users avoid information overload and focus on what matters most.

  • Timely Updates: Users receive timely updates on significant developments, enabling them to make informed decisions based on the latest market intelligence.

Steps of the Setup:

The setup process for the Portfolio News Tracker bot is intuitive and organized into five steps, allowing users to tailor the bot’s functionality to their specific needs.

1. Define Basics

  • Batch Name: Start by assigning a name to the news tracking workflow. This name helps in identifying and managing multiple workflows within the platform.

  • Description: Add a description to provide context or specify the focus of the news tracking, such as which portfolio or types of news are most relevant.

2. Frequency Setup

  • Single or Recurring Execution: Users can choose whether the workflow runs just once or on a recurring schedule. This option is particularly useful for ongoing monitoring where continuous updates are needed.

3. Concept Selection

  • Selecting Concepts: Users can select the specific concepts that will guide the news filtering process. This ensures that the bot focuses on the most pertinent information for the user’s portfolio.

4. Entity Choice

  • Entity Selection: In this step, users select the entities (such as companies or sectors) within their portfolio that they want the bot to monitor. This helps in narrowing down the news feed to only those entities of interest.

5. Confirmation Receipt

  • Review and Confirmation: Before execution, users can review the workflow’s scope and settings. Once confirmed, the bot will start monitoring and aggregating news according to the defined parameters.
